EDI (Electronic Data Interchange) differs from e-Commerce in that ___________________.

The correct answer is A. EDI involves only computer to computer transactions.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) is distinct from general e-commerce because it involves the direct, automated computer-to-computer exchange of standardized business documents.

Why each option

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) is distinct from general e-commerce because it involves the direct, automated computer-to-computer exchange of standardized business documents.

AEDI involves only computer to computer transactionsCorrect

EDI is characterized by highly structured, machine-to-machine transactions for the exchange of business documents, minimizing human intervention and facilitating automated processing.

BE-Commerce involves only computer to computer transactions

E-commerce encompasses a broader range of electronic transactions, including those involving human interaction, not exclusively computer-to-computer exchanges.

CEDI allows companies to take credit cards directly to consumers via the web

EDI is primarily focused on Business-to-Business (B2B) document exchange, not direct consumer credit card processing via the web, which is typical of retail e-commerce.

DNone of the items listed accurately reflect the differences between EDI and e-Commerce

Option A accurately describes a key difference between EDI and e-commerce, making this choice incorrect.
